Is there the color-flavor locking in the instanton induced quark-antiquark pairing in QCD vacuum?
Abstract
By means of the functional integral method we show that in the case of the quark-antiquark pairing at zero temperature and zero chemical potential (in the vacuum) the singlet pairing is more preferable than that with the color-flavor locking (CFL)
